1. Exploring Finance: Discounting Discounting Conceptual Overview: Explore the amount $1 is discounted for different compound interest rates across time. The graph shows the discounted value of $1 over time Move the slider to change the compound interest rate and observe how the curve for the present value of $1 changes. The red dotted cursor lines show the present value of $1 at a specific time period in the future.
